How Gun Transfers Work in New Hampshire

In New Hampshire, transferring a firearm through an FFL dealer is straightforward. Here's the process:

  1. Purchase your firearm online or from a private party and provide your chosen dealer's FFL info to the seller.
  2. Dealer receives the shipment and contacts you when your firearm arrives.
  3. Visit the dealer with a valid government-issued photo ID, complete ATF Form 4473 and NICS background check.
  4. Pay the transfer fee and take possession of your firearm.

What ID do I need for a gun transfer in New Hampshire?
A valid government-issued photo ID showing your current address — a New Hampshire driver's license is standard.
Can I use an FFL dealer in Concord for a private party transfer?
Yes. Private party transfers are one of the most common uses for FFL dealers. The seller ships or brings the firearm to the dealer, who processes the legal transfer to you.
